1、刪除重復記錄,只保留一條記錄。注意,subject,RECEIVER 要索引,否則會很慢的。
琿春網(wǎng)站建設公司成都創(chuàng)新互聯(lián),琿春網(wǎng)站設計制作,有大型網(wǎng)站制作公司豐富經(jīng)驗。已為琿春上千家提供企業(yè)網(wǎng)站建設服務。企業(yè)網(wǎng)站搭建\成都外貿網(wǎng)站制作要多少錢,請找那個售后服務好的琿春做網(wǎng)站的公司定做!
2、mysql多個字段如何去重復的數(shù)據(jù) MySQL查詢重復字段,及刪除重復記錄的方法 數(shù)據(jù)庫中有個大表,需要查找其中的名字有重復的記錄id,以便比較。
3、在 SQL 中,這是很容易做到的。我們只要在 SELECT 后加上一個 DISTINCT 就可以了。
對于第一種重復,比較容易解決,使用 select distinct * from tableName就可以得到無重復記錄的結果集。
delete from t1,(select a from t1 group by a having count(1)1) t where ta=t.a;如果希望對于有重復的記錄只保留其中一條而不是全部刪除,則可運行下列語句,前提是數(shù)據(jù)表必須含有自增id列。
mysql數(shù)據(jù)表中有多條重復數(shù)據(jù)記錄,現(xiàn)在想刪除刪除部分重復數(shù)據(jù),保留最后一條更新或者插入的數(shù)據(jù)。
select distinct可以去掉重復記錄。disctinct將重復的記錄忽略,但它忽略的是完全一致的重復記錄,而不是其中某個字段重復的記錄,或者說,distinct查詢一個字段時好使,多個字段就不好使。
刪除重復記錄,只保留一條記錄。注意,subject,RECEIVER 要索引,否則會很慢的。
過濾重復數(shù)據(jù)有些 MySQL 數(shù)據(jù)表中可能存在重復的記錄,有些情況我們允許重復數(shù)據(jù)的存在,但有時候我們也需要刪除這些重復的數(shù)據(jù)。如果你需要讀取不重復的數(shù)據(jù)可以在 SELECT 語句中使用 DISTINCT 關鍵字來過濾重復數(shù)據(jù)。
MySQL查詢重復字段,及刪除重復記錄的方法 數(shù)據(jù)庫中有個大表,需要查找其中的名字有重復的記錄id,以便比較。
聯(lián)合表查詢查出所有字段肯定是這樣,因為查的是一個主表下的子表信息。那么子表對應的主表信息都一致了。
,應盡量避免在 where 子句中使用!=或操作符, MySQL只有對以下操作符才使用索引:,=,=,,=,BETWEEN,IN,以及某些時候的LIKE。
這個需要分情況。 1,你的數(shù)據(jù)庫表中有主鍵,且主鍵上面的數(shù)據(jù)為唯一值。也就是沒有重復值。 那么你在刪除的時候,將這個唯一值作為條件進行刪除。
大家在這里回答問題純粹就是助人為樂,度娘的分值咩用都木。沒有老土的SQL,只有沒有經(jīng)驗的數(shù)據(jù)庫初學者,說這么多,直接看VIEW是通過哪些表創(chuàng)建的,直接在這些表里面group by不就行了。
mysql數(shù)據(jù)庫去除重復數(shù)據(jù)的方法:查詢需要刪除的記錄,會保留一條記錄。
如果你想刪除數(shù)據(jù)表中的重復數(shù)據(jù),你可以使用以下的SQL語句:from 樹懶學堂 - 一站式數(shù)據(jù)知識平臺 當然你也可以在數(shù)據(jù)表中添加 INDEX(索引) 和 PRIMAY KEY(主鍵)這種簡單的方法來刪除表中的重復記錄。
SQL: select distinct name,id from user SQL :select name from user group by name group by理解:表里的某一個字段(比如:name) 當出現(xiàn)相同的數(shù)據(jù)時,group by就將這2條數(shù)據(jù)合二為一。name就顯示一條 數(shù)據(jù)了。
MySQL查詢重復字段,及刪除重復記錄的方法 數(shù)據(jù)庫中有個大表,需要查找其中的名字有重復的記錄id,以便比較。
這個需要分情況。1,你的數(shù)據(jù)庫表中有主鍵,且主鍵上面的數(shù)據(jù)為唯一值。也就是沒有重復值。那么你在刪除的時候,將這個唯一值作為條件進行刪除。
名稱欄目:mysql查詢怎么去重的簡單介紹
新聞來源:http://aaarwkj.com/article22/dgdscjc.html
成都網(wǎng)站建設公司_創(chuàng)新互聯(lián),為您提供外貿建站、品牌網(wǎng)站設計、網(wǎng)站改版、網(wǎng)頁設計公司、App設計、電子商務
聲明:本網(wǎng)站發(fā)布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經(jīng)允許不得轉載,或轉載時需注明來源: 創(chuàng)新互聯(lián)